How they compare
Tajikistan currently reports 194,365 against 184,836 in Switzerland, a difference of 9,529.
That makes Tajikistan's figure about 1.1 times Switzerland's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Switzerland ahead.
Switzerland ranks 100th and Tajikistan ranks 97th of 220 countries.
Switzerland has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Switzerland | Tajikist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 177,537 | 158,649 | 18,888 | Switzerland |
| 2010s | 180,959 | 172,897 | 8,062 | Switzerland |
| 2020s | 175,448 | 166,566 | 8,882 | Switzerland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
